I guess I don't understand. Spacers are relatively cheap and wheel weights are more expensive, but would help immensely on hilly terrain. I have mine loaded with Rimguard and extended 4" on each side and the 61" bucket works fine, but I don't live on a hill.

So what if the bucket doesn't totally cover the tracks. I suppose any 3 pt. equipment that is narrow that works on small tractors but don't cover the whole track on a larger tractor might give a person fits now and then.

Replacing a nice tractor like that with a few hours on it might be doable but the trade I would think would be a money loser.
To trade for something you think might be more stable with that horsepower and all those features would be a big tractor with a wide wheel base which is what spacers would do here.

I own an open station 3720 and my observations are as follows:

Cab tractors should roll easier to remind the owners that money cannot insulate them from reality

Was a drive-over auto-attach mid-mount ever made for a 3xxx?

Tippy is relative - Not such a big deal with a 6-foot RC and plenty of downhill area for turnout, terrifying with a loaded bucket and a pond bank cave in

Get in the habit of wearing your seatbelt, if you feel nervous you should change your driving habits, always ballast correctly for your attachment.

Congratulations on your tractor, mine has done everything I have asked of it without complaint. Take Care.
